Can AI Write Your Content, or Do You Still Need a Human Touch?

For Kristen Sears, Spring Insight’s resident content maven, 2025 has been a year of wild experimentation with AI—and a big reminder of where the line is.

Sure, AI can crank out ideas and outlines faster than you can unwrap a Snickers. But Kristen’s biggest takeaway? You can’t automate authenticity. In digital marketing, the human touch is irreplaceable.

“You can have AI spit out all the content you want, but if you don’t know who you’re writing for—or what really matters to you—it’s just noise.” 

  • Her trick: use AI as a partner, not the boss.
  • Her treat: when you bring the human touch—your stories, your voice, your real-life perspective—your audience actually connects.

In a world overflowing with machine-generated content, authenticity is the real treat.

How Can Marketing Automation Free Up Time for Strategy and Creativity?

Laura B. Mayer, who leads our web development and marketing operations, has been deep in the trenches of automation this year—and loving it.

For Laura, the trick isn’t about automating everything. It’s about knowing where humans matter most.

“We look at those points where it’s key to have a human involved, and then create automations for all the other pieces so we can focus on creativity and strategy.”

The result? Less manual drudgery, more time to dream big. 

Spring Insight has been able to automate dashboards, email funnels, and reporting—freeing up hours for deep thinking, not data entry.

Automation isn’t scary when it’s done right—it’s like hiring a team of invisible assistants who never forget deadlines or take lunch breaks.

Why Does Consistency Still Matter in a Fast-Changing Marketing Landscape?

2025 has been the year of “shiny new tools,” and Penny Barrentine has one word of advice: breathe.

Between the rapid-fire launches of new AI platforms, content tools, and social algorithms, Penny’s insight is simple but crucial: don’t lose your message in the madness.

“Being consistent and adaptable through all the changes has been essential—not just for us, but for our clients.”

  • Her trick: don’t chase every new tool.
  • Her treat: consistency builds trust. When your audience knows what to expect from your brand, they’ll follow you through every tech shift.

FAQs

What’s the biggest marketing lesson of 2025?

AI and automation are great tools—but they only work when guided by real strategy and human connection.

Can AI replace content creators?

Not even close. AI helps with speed and structure, but your brand’s voice and authenticity can’t be replicated.

How can small teams use automation effectively?

Start small—automate repetitive tasks like reports or email follow-ups so you can focus on creativity and client work.

What is Generative AI Optimization (GAIO)?

GAIO helps ensure your website and content are discoverable and recommended by AI tools like ChatGPT, Gemini, and Perplexity.
